For those who prefer inexpensive potato meals, I suggest a simple recipe for cooking potato pancakes (draniki). The variants of this pankakes are typical for various European cuisine.

This recipe will satisfy the demands of vegetarians or adherents of a healthy diet, and I strongly advise you to try it! The benefit of this tasty dish over others is a fast and easy cooking process with minimum ingredients. Draniki are served to the table hot with sour cream. To make the potato pancake consistency more tender, the recipe does not include flour and eggs, and the dish consists of five ingredients not counting salt and pepper. 

Ingredients

  • Potatoes — 300 g.
  • Onion — 100 g. 
  • Garlic — 2 cloves
  • Sour cream — 2 tbs. to serve
  • Salt and black ground pepper — to taste
  • Sunflower oil — 3 tbs.

Step 1. Peel the onion and grate it. We start cooking with onion to prevent the grated potatoes from darkening.

Step 2. Start grating potatoes. They need to be high in starch. Young summer vegetables are not suitable for this recipe — big potatoes with a rough skin and a yellowish core suit well. Peel the potatoes and grate them on a coarse grater. You can also use a blender.

Step 3. Mix with onion and finely chopped garlic. Then pepper and salt the potato dough to taste. It is important to let the excess liquid drain. This will help draniki to keep their form while cooking.

Step 4. Heat the vegetable oil in a frying pan. The amount of oil should be anough so that the potato-onion mixture can soak in it. For such a volume of ingredients seven to eight pancakes are obtained. It means one large or two small portions.
